Permalink Reply by archibald on May 19, 2014 at 3:16pm Did you have any luck getting an EQT lease that was free of deducts? Thanks
Permalink Reply by Nancy Mosley on May 19, 2014 at 4:23pm FYI...the guy who was in charge of leasing (at least for WV. Don't know whether he was responsible for other states or not) who occasionally gave a gross lease (we got one about a year ago) was replaced by someone who refuses to allow gross leases. This was the status a few months ago. Don't know what is happening now.
